Pupil Registration Information
Pupil registration will take place throughout the school year at the office of Pupil Personnel Services, located at 148 Wood Avenue, Monticello, New York. These offices are located in the lower level of Monticello High School. Persons wishing to enroll their child in any of the Monticello schools, are asked to call 794-0128 and schedule an appointment with the district registrar. This includes families who are residing with relatives in the district.

In order to facilitate the registration process, parents must bring documentation which verifies proof of residency. This can include: a driver's license showing current physical address, current rent receipt showing family name and physical address, current service bill from gas, oil or electric showing family name and the address where the service is delivered to (not the mailing address,) current voter registration card or a current lease signed by the tenant and the landlord. Mortgage statements are not accepted as proof of residence.

An appropriate birth certificate, an up-to-date immunization record, and social security card must also be provided.

Join the Monticello Schools bands and choruses
Getting your child involved in clubs and activities is a great way for your child to make friends. Over 400 students are enrolled in Monticello bands and orchestras, and over 500 students are involved in school choruses. Monticello even offers AP music, a course in which students may be able to earn college credits. Click here to find out more information.
